Transaction 42df99b81526e1a91c9ca33c64125ee60d090be627da279e7744b33e2ad7da77
1 Input
1 Output
-
42df99b81526e1a91c9ca33c64125ee60d090be627da279e7744b33e2ad7da77:0
- value
- 66176443
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e20c3578fd6b6021c0bebd2b6c118721fe65a8f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1McELeCVqV5vEwRPDhgWjXL5zpwwvRrWHF